web-dev-qa-db-fra.com

Retrait de l'efi de repli de refind

J'ai installé la dernière version de refind pour gérer un fichier ssd partitionné avec OSX et Ubuntu. Cela fonctionne très bien et a été configuré exactement comme je le voulais jusqu'à une récente mise à jour de dist.

Pour une raison quelconque, mon menu de démarrage de refind affiche une option permettant d’amorcer le repli depuis EFI avec une icône unknown_os. La sélection de cette option me prend au dépourvu.

J'ai regardé dans mon répertoire EFI qui contient /EFI/bootx64.efi ainsi que bootx64.efi.grb. Il contient également les sous-répertoires standard ubuntu et Apple contenant les fichiers firmware.scap, grub, skim et mokmanager.

Existe-t-il un moyen sûr de supprimer l'entrée de secours de mon menu de démarrage telle qu'elle était auparavant?

Merci.

1
bleeves

Bien sûr, il existe un moyen sûr de masquer une entrée du menu de démarrage de rEFInd.

Je vous suggère d'utiliser le paramètre "dont_scan_files" ou "ne_san_fichiers" dans "refind.conf".

Pour ajouter le fichier EFI à masquer en plus des fichiers par défaut, vous pouvez utiliser les éléments suivants:

dont_scan_files + NameOfTheEFILoaderToHide.efi

Pour plus de détails sur la configuration de rEFInd Boot Manager, n'hésitez pas à consulter documentation officielle .

Pour identifier le ou les fichiers EFI que vous souhaitez conserver ou masquer, efibootmgr peut vous aider à obtenir une liste des entrées du menu EFI avec le fichier EFI correspondant.

  1. Sous Ubuntu, ouvrez un terminal et installez "efibootmgr", s'il n'est pas déjà installé, en utilisant la commande suivante:

    Sudo apt-get install efibootmgr

  2. Récupérez l'ordre de démarrage EFI et les entrées à l'aide de la commande:

    Sudo efibootmgr -v

Remarques:

BootCurrent: 0002 (indique l'entrée de démarrage UEFI utilisée pour le démarrage).

BootOrder: 0002,0003,0001,0000 (indique l'ordre de démarrage UEFI défini).

Boot000x * (représente une entrée d'amorçage. Il est suivi de son nom, du fichier HD et EFI. Toutes les entrées d'amorçage sont répertoriées sous "BootOrder").

3
Golboth